Specs
Massdrop x Sennheiser
Glossy black headband, gray metal grilles
Ear coupling: Over-ear (circumaural)
Transducer principle: Open, dynamic
Impedance: 150 ohms
Frequency response: 12–38,500 Hz (-10 dB)
THD + N: < 0.1% at 1 kHz, 100 dB
Sound pressure level: 104 dB at 1V, 1 kHz
Connector: ⅛ in (3.5 mm) gold-plated stereo jack plug
Cable: 6 ft (1.8 m) OFC, detachable
Weight without cable: Approx. 9.2 oz (260 g)
Individually serialized
Made in Ireland

Included
¼ in (6.35 mm) adapter
Manufacturer’s 2-year warranty

  • How do these compare in sound quality to the Bose QC35? Obviously the Senns are not noise cancelling.

    I have the Bose at the moment, just wondering if there is any point in getting a set of these for home (wired) use.

    Would it also be worth budgeting for an amp to power these? If so, any suggestions?

    • These are open bacpk head phones, what you hear someone else will be able to hear too, you may want an amp but you could still use it without an amp

      • The impedance is 150 ohms, you definitely need an amp, otherwise you may as well just get normal headphones.

        • They don't "definitely" need an amp, but they would sound better with one. My HD 6XX's get plenty loud enough connected to my iPhone 7 through the Fiio i1 (which hardly amps the signal at all), and they're 300 ohms. However, they do perform better connected to my JDS Element DAC/amp.
